In the 1970s, a Minnesota couple's farm cat Jezabelle gave birth to two hairless cats, Epidermis and Dermis. GENERAL: the most distinctive feature of this cat is its appearance of hairlessness, although Sphynx are not actually completely hairless cats and there should be some evidence of hair on the bridge of the nose and the ears. While Sphynx are generally healthy, they are at a higher risk for hypertrophic cardiomyopathy, the most common heart disease in cats. The first Sphynx was born to a pair of domestic shorthair cats in Toronto, Canada in 1966, the result of a spontaneous natural genetic mutation, which occurs with some regularity among felines. CINNAMON TABBY: skin ground color, including lips and chin, a pale, warm honey, markings a dense cinnamon, affording a good contrast with skin ground color.

Because they dont have hair to absorb sebaceous oils secreted by a cats skin, they require bathing every few weeks with a natural, gentle shampoo.

The Sphynx was accepted into the miscellaneous class by the CFA in 1998 and earned championship status in 2002. When sleepy, a Sphynx heads for a warm place, usually under the covers. The easiest way to ensure a Sphynx does not become too cold is to heat your home constantly (day and night) so that its always in the range of 68 F to 77 F.
